Re: incremental rebuilds in Thornpress — the dependency walk here is unbounded. A change to the shared footer will dirty the whole Ashgrove docs tree and we'll rebuild everything anyway, minus the caching wins. Cap the traversal depth and fall back to a full rebuild past the cutoff. Suggested limits below.

tuning table, bajog-kahip:
RATE_LIMITS = {
    "holwyn": 2,
    "oliael": 5,
}

## Onboarding — Markdown Pipeline (Inkmere)

Inkmere docs render through a three-stage pipeline: parse, sanitize, emit. Releases rebuild all templates; never hot-patch emitted HTML. Broken renders usually mean a sanitizer rule change — check the rules diff first. The render cluster only accepts builds from the release channel, and every build artifact must be signed before upload. Sign artifacts with the deploy key below.

release key, hafop-tajef: bky13_s2vaFVNJTHfBL

**Where is the quiet room and how do I get in?**

The quiet room is on the top floor of the Marwick Building, directly opposite the lift lobby. It's available to all staff for focused work, calls to family, or simply a break from the open plan. No booking is needed, but please keep noise to a minimum and limit stays to two hours during busy periods. The door stays locked at all times; enter using the code below.

door code, yagap-bahof: bdg-O-05

// When a component's rendered output changes intentionally, bump this
// constant and regenerate baselines with the `refresh-snaps` task;
// otherwise the comparison job will flag every diff as a regression.
// New contractors: never hand-edit files under snapshots/baseline —
// they are generated and checksummed at build time, and manual edits
// break the verification step in CI. Each regeneration is tied to a
// specific pipeline run. The run's token is recorded on the next line.

pipeline stamp: htk3_69f

# Basement Archive Room — Night Access

The archive room under Pellworth House holds old contracts and the tape backups. Night shift: take stairwell C, not the lift (it's switched off after midnight). Lights are on a timer by the door — slap the button as you go in. Sign the logbook, even at 3am, yes really. The keypad by the door takes the code below.

staff pass of fahap-tajeg = bdg-FT-6